MediaCom Takes CMA Best In Show For Pennzoil's Mario Karting

MediaCom took "Best In Show" and also won the New/Emerging/Experimental Media category during the 2015 Creative Media Awards in New York City Wednesday night. Fittingly for the day of the week, Horizon Media won the Media Plan category for its "Caleb the Camel" campaign for GEICO.

Other than MediaCom, the only other agencies to win more than one category were Hill Holliday (which took top honors in the Creative category for its "#DunkinReplay" campaign for Dunkin' Donuts and in the TV/Interactive/Enhanced TV category for John Hancock's "Life Comes Next" campaign) and Mediahub/Mullen (which won the Online Branding category for American Greetings and Research/Consumer Insights category for Bose).

Acceptance remarks were generally short, polite and to the point, except for OMD's Leslie Rasimas, who while accepting top honors in the Performance category for the agency's "Someday" campaign for Tourism Australia, made a dig at rival Starcom MediaVest's win in the Mobile category for its Montana Office of Tourism campaign.

"We encourage you to come to Australia over Montana, anyday," she said tongue in cheek. Perhaps she meant "someday."

In any case, CMA host Persia Tatar followed by quipping, "That sounds like a throwdown, OMD. What's up?"

Winners in each category are listed below.

Audio: "Call of Duty Advanced Warfare: Seeding the Kevin Spacey Speech" by Edelman for Activision / Call of Duty

Branded Entertainment: "The 4 to 9ers: The Day Crew" by Content & Co for Subway Restaurants
Business Media: "Small Business Saturday Media" by DigitasLBi for American Express
Content Marketing (including native): "The Lexus LS - Vision Beyond the Visible" by Team One for Lexus USA
Creative: "#DunkinReplay" by Hill Holliday for Dunkin' Donuts
Media Plan: "Caleb the Camel" by Horizon Media for GEICO
Mobile Media: "Montana Turns $25K Into $6.9MM" by Starcom MediaVest Group for Montana Office of Tourism
Multicultural Media: "DishLATINO Juego Bonito by Havas Media for DishLATINO"
New/Emerging/Experimental Media (excluding online): "Mario Karting Reimagined by MediaCom for Pennzoil"
Online Media (Branding): "World's Toughest Job" by Mediahub/Mullen for American Greetings
Online Media (Search): "Turning Flight Cancellations into Hotel Reservations" by Red Roof Inn & 360i for Red Roof Inn
Outdoor Media: "Celebrating the First Coffee Created on Pinterest With the World’s Largest Pinterest Board"  by Colle+McVoy for Caribou Coffee
Performance Media & Marketing (including Direct Response, TV, Email, etc.): "Someday" by OMD for Tourism Australia
Print (magazines and newspapers): "Dominion Poster Campaign" by Syfy for Dominion
Research/Consumer Insights: "Dive In" by Mediahub/Mullen for Bose
Social Media: "Tap For Trainers" by SapientNitro for Sky Rainforest Rescue
TV or Interactive/Enhanced TV: "Life Comes Next" by Hill Holliday for John Hancock
